Global K-POP sensation IVE recently ventured into uncharted culinary territory on “Buzz Bites @ BuzzFeed Celeb” with their highly anticipated segment, “IVE Tries American Foods For The First Time.” The video, subtitled in English, instantly captivated international DIVE, eager to witness their beloved idols’ reactions to a spread of classic American snacks and fast-food staples.
The episode delivered a delightful mix of curiosity and candid reactions. Leader Yujin, famously known among fans for her discerning palate and deep love for Korean cuisine, was a particular point of interest. While many anticipated low scores, the undeniable allure of bacon proved to be a universal winner, seemingly transcending her usual preferences. Meanwhile, Rei’s adventurous spirit shone brightly, with her positive take on fried pickles quickly becoming a viral talking point. “My palette seems to align with Rei’s, so I think I’m going to have to try those fried pickles,” one fan excitedly shared, highlighting the video’s instant influence on DIVE’s snack lists.
